Ruisseau le Miodex
Ruisseau le Miodex is a stream in Puy-de-Dôme, Auvergne,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es. Ruisseau le Miodex is situated nearby to the locality Sauviat, as well as near the hamlet Le Clos.| Tap on a place to explore it |
